In which scenario would a practical engine cycle be more applicable than an ideal engine cycle?.

  1. A.When analyzing the theoretical limits of efficiency.
  2. B.When designing a new engine based on perfect conditions.
  3. C.When evaluating the performance of a real-world engine.
  4. D.When calculating the maximum work output possible.

Model answer

What a good answer should say

  • When evaluating the performance of a real-world engine.

Explanation

Why this works

A practical engine cycle is defined as one that considers real-world factors such as friction and heat loss, making it applicable for evaluating actual engine performance. The key difference is that ideal cycles do not account for these losses, which are significant in practical applications.

Practical cycles apply when assessing engines in real conditions, while ideal cycles are used for theoretical analysis. Thus, the correct option emphasizes the relevance of practical cycles in real-world evaluations.
